WebJun 23, 2015 · An emergency situation is one in which the safety of the aircraft or of persons on board or on the ground is endangered for any reason. An abnormal situation is one in which it is no longer possiible to continue the flight using normal procedures but the safety of the aircraft or persons on board or on the ground is not in danger. Web14 CFR 107.21 - In-flight emergency. View all text of Subpart B [§ 107.11 - § 107.51] § 107.21 - In-flight emergency. (a) In an in-flight emergency requiring immediate action, the remote pilot in command may deviate from any rule of this part to the extent necessary to meet that emergency. The remote … WebMay 3, 2024 · In Category 1, the FAA states a UAV needs to weigh 0.55 pounds or less, including payloads at the time of takeoff and throughout each operation, and can’t contain exposed rotating parts. On the other hand, Categories 2 and 3 focus on UAVs that weigh more than 0.55 pounds but do not have an airworthiness certificate under part 21.
